About Awakenings by the Sea - Drug Rehab in Seaside, OR

Awakenings by the Sea is a distinguished, women-only addiction treatment center located in the scenic coastal town of Seaside, Oregon. As the sole facility in the Pacific Northwest holding both ASAM and CARF accreditations, they offer a trusted, high-quality standard of care. With an intimate, 18-bed capacity, the program provides a homelike atmosphere where women can heal in a safe and supportive community. Their evidence-based approach addresses both substance use and co-occurring mental health disorders, offering a continuum of care that includes medical detox and residential treatment. Designed for women by a Betty Ford clinical veteran, Awakenings by the Sea focuses on personalized healing, fostering lasting recovery against the calming backdrop of the ocean.

Amenities & More Info

Chef-Prepared MealsNutritious meals prepared by a cook, with accommodations for dietary needs like vegetarian.
Shared RoomsClients share a room with a roommate, fostering peer support and a sense of community.
Smoking PermittedSmoking and vaping are allowed in designated outdoor areas.
Limited Phone UseAfter a 7-day blackout, clients can use their phones for one hour on weekdays and two hours on weekends.
MAT PermittedMedication-Assisted Treatment, including Suboxone, is permitted as part of a client's treatment plan.
Out-of-NetworkThis is a private facility that does not accept Medicaid. They work with most PPO/POS insurance plans as an out-of-network provider.
Gym & YogaClients have access to gym memberships and participate in yoga sessions as part of the holistic program.
Weekend OutingsOn Sundays, clients enjoy recreational outings like bowling, movies, and beach walks.
Aftercare PlanningComprehensive discharge planning and an aftercare program to support long-term recovery.
